Is Fuel Included in a Novated Lease?
Yes, it usually is. One of the top benefits of a novated lease from Vehicle Solutions is the ability to pay for fuel with a fuel card provider using pre-tax salary, which can significantly lower your taxable income.
Here’s how it works:
- Your fuel card is preloaded based on estimated fuel usage.
- You simply swipe it at most major fuel retailers across Australia.
- The fuel spend is already factored into your one regular payment, so no out-of-pocket cost or need to keep receipts.
Other Benefits of a Novated Lease
Fuel cards are just one part of a smarter, stress-free ownership experience through novated lease. With Vehicle Solutions, your novated lease also includes other running costs and benefits like:
Servicing and Maintenance
Covers all scheduled logbook services as per the manufacturer’s guidelines, typically every 10,000–15,000 km or every 6–12 months, whichever comes first. Services can be completed at authorised dealerships or accredited mechanics nationwide.
Tyres, Batteries & Windscreen Repairs
You’ll get replacements for up to four new tyres every 40,000–50,000 km, battery changes when needed, and windscreen chips or cracks covered under your plan. It depends on the wear cycle and lease term.
Registration & Roadside Assistance
All state registration costs and CTP (Compulsory Third Party) insurance are included in your lease. Plus, 24/7 roadside assistance is included, covering breakdowns, flat tyres, battery jump-starts, and towing if needed.
Car Insurance
Your lease includes comprehensive car insurance, often with options to set your excess (usually $500–$1,000) to suit your budget. Vehicle Solutions can connect you with nationally recognised insurers with strong claims support.
Fuel Costs
Through the included fuel card, you can purchase fuel at over 90% of service stations in Australia, including major providers such as Shell, BP, 7-Eleven, Coles Express, and Caltex Woolworths. Your employer loads the card according to your agreed-upon fuel budget, and you swipe it as needed.
GST Savings
You don’t pay GST on the purchase price of your new car, nor the ongoing running costs (like fuel, tyres, insurance, or servicing). That’s a 10% saving upfront and ongoing, which, on a $45,000 car, is a $4,500 benefit right off the bat.
No Receipts or Reimbursements
Forget the paperwork. All vehicle expenses are paid through your employer before tax is taken out. You don’t need to keep fuel receipts or claim reimbursements from payroll. It’s all automated.
A Case Study
Let’s say you lease a Mazda CX-5 G25 Touring AWD with a drive-away price of $48,000:
- You save ~$4,800 in GST (10%).
- You can save $2,500–$4,000/year in tax by packaging fuel, rego, servicing, insurance, and tyres into your pre-tax salary.
- Your fuel card works at Coles Express and stacks with a 4c per litre discount.
Over a standard 5-year lease, that’s potentially $10,000–$14,000 in total savings depending on your income bracket and vehicle usage.

Who Owns the Car Under a Novated Lease?
In short: you do.
While your employer facilitates the lease by deducting repayments from your pre-tax salary, the vehicle is registered in your name. You get full control over the car make, model, features, and even where you get it serviced.
At the end of the lease term, you can:
- Pay out the residual to own the car outright
- Refinance or upgrade to a newer model
- Or simply return the vehicle and walk away
You’re not tied down, and you get all the perks of car ownership with added tax savings and budgeting convenience.
